It is definitely a buyer's market right now. As interests rates are going up (which they have sigmificantly in the last couple of months), it is getting more difficult to get the same high prices for houses that you could have gotten 6 mths to a year ago. Good luck! The only good news if you don't get THIS house (as perfect as it may seem), is that it is a buyer's market and prices don't look like they will be going up soon.
